Room 36 was lovely (ground floor sea view (car park side) spacious and clean. After checking in at main desk we were escorted to our room with a staff member who kindly carried some luggage. As it was a special trip (birthday) the staff kindly left a nice surprise of two wee bottles of prosecco, which was a lovely touch. After settling in we headed down to the leisure centre to use pool and spa facilities. I was most disappointed that the jacuzzi was out of order (it seems to be the case across many leisure centres ive visited recently where the costs of running them likely to be too high as a result of the energy prices at the moment. However the receptionist advised it had broken down on the morning of our stay and it wouldnt be a few days until they got the maintenance parts required to fix it. Nevertheless we made use of the steam room and pool.) Despite it being summer, it was surprisingly quiet, there was maybe only one or two other families in. The pool is open throughout the day until 9pm, slots tend to be 2hrs each of 'family time' and adults only alternating. They have lockers which you do not need to take a £1 coin to operate and as we were staying in the hotel we were provided with robes and slippers. We forgot to take the slippers with us (i used my own flip flops), the pool reception doesn't keep spare slippers as they dont recommend you wear anything on your feet as it gets quite slippy. After about 2 hours we headed back up to room to get ready for dinner in The Rabbit restaurant. We were greeted by restaurant staff and placed at a table in the middle section. We shared a starter, a main each and shared a pudding. Although a seaside location, i would have liked to have seen a bit more selection on the menu, a chicken dish other than a curry. My mum had fish and chips and i opted for the curry. It wasnt a chicken breast curry (chopped or full breast), but still it was nice.

We booked a Double room with seaview, however, we arrived at night & it was a car park view. So, we went back down & got upgraded by the lovely lady night receptionist Joan to the Carmichael Suite, which was fabulous, with separate living room & bedroom areas. What I liked about this hotel was the decor in the lobby, breakfast, bar areas, traditional & tastefully finished. Gave us New England, Maine, Old Course Hotel & Troon vibes. We live in Dubai, so refreshing to experience traditional interior. There is a beautiful golf course between the hotel & sea, doesn’t hinder the seaview from any floor on a clear day. The bed was extremely comfortable, TV in both rooms. Very spacious rooms & a lovely bath with high quality Floris of London toiletries. Breakfast was fab and comes with a view. We visited the gym, pool areas both open & there is a pool table in a lovely decorated area. All staff were great, for Scotland, they were great, kudos. The hotel is very fortunate to have such diligent employees. I would visit again but I’d only book the Suites, seems the double or king bedrooms isn’t as advertised. Be careful with pristine pictures, might present a false reality.

We were there for our wedding anniversary and required a complimentary upgrade which was lovely! We had a sea view and the suite was very spacious. The staff were friendly and attentive. Breakfast had a good variety to choose from, plus delicious cooked options. We dined in the restaurant one evening - food was excellent. The lounge bar was very comfortable for sitting around in to have a few drinks before/after dinner. Complimentary game on the mini putting green at the front was fun! Pool and spa area was very clean, if not particularly fancy. Jacuzzi has a lovely view out to sea! My husband used the gym and said it had good options for working out.
